Abstract

A method and results of model studies of the operation of a proposed new system for mechanized feeding of filler sand to the ladle nozzle are presented. The design solutions incorporated into the system and the relationships obtained to justify its energy-force parameters are validated.

期刊介绍: Metallurgist is the leading Russian journal in metallurgy. Publication started in 1956. Basic topics covered include: State of the art and development of enterprises in ferrous and nonferrous metallurgy and mining; Metallurgy of ferrous, nonferrous, rare, and precious metals; Metallurgical equipment; Automation and control; Protection of labor; Protection of the environment; Resources and energy saving; Quality and certification; History of metallurgy; Inventions (patents).
